From ad4d6a06f32382b0417fe87cbb8afb420758130a Mon Sep 17 00:00:00 2001 From: Andrew Cady Date: Sun, 30 Apr 2023 15:50:21 -0400 Subject: add more options --- ssh-check | 14 ++++++++++++-- 1 file changed, 12 insertions(+), 2 deletions(-) diff --git a/ssh-check b/ssh-check index df5274b..5045bb1 100755 --- a/ssh-check +++ b/ssh-check @@ -49,7 +49,7 @@ main() do [ $# = 0 ] || match "$h" "$@" || continue - ( if uptime=$(ssh $SSH_OPTIONS -n "$h" -- uptime 2>/dev/null) + ( if uptime=$(ssh $SSH_OPTIONS -n "$h" -- ${REMOTE_COMMAND:-uptime} 2>/dev/null) then printf "%-15s %-${host_field_width}s %s\n" "Succeeded:" "$h" "${uptime# }" else @@ -79,14 +79,24 @@ edit_config() rm "$f".timestamp } +usage() +{ + cat <&2; exit 1 ;; *) break;; esac shift -- cgit v1.2.3